Weather in January

January, like December, in Pelawatta, Sri Lanka, is a moderately hot winter month, with an average temperature fluctuating between 18.8°C (65.8°F) and 29.3°C (84.7°F).

Temperature

The advent of January brings an average high-temperature of a still warm 29.3°C (84.7°F), exhibiting minor difference from the previous month. Throughout the month of January, Pelawatta sees a steady low-temperature average of 18.8°C (65.8°F).

Heat index

For most parts of January, the heat index is appraised at a very hot 36°C (96.8°F). Heightened safety actions are necessary, heat cramps and heat exhaustion are probable. Persistent activity may lead to heatstroke.
When assessing, remember that heat index measurements are for light winds and shaded spots. The heat index can potentially augment by 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ees due to direct sunlight.
Note: The heat index, also known as 'real feel' or 'felt air temperature', reflects the feeling of heat when considering both air temperature and humidity. The individual's experience of temperature can be shaped by numerous aspects such as metabolic variations, physical exertion, and attire. When directly under the sun, the weather's impact can intensify, possibly boosting the heat index by 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ees. Heat index values are highly critical for babies and toddlers. In general, younger individuals are at greater risk than adults because they tend to sweat less. Also, having a larger skin surface to body size ratio and greater heat production due to their active behavior contribute to this danger.
The physiological way the human body responds to excessive heat is by inducing perspiration, using sweat evaporation as a cooling mechanism. During high air temperature and humidity (high heat index), the process of perspiration is hindered, intensifying the sensation of heat. Heat disorders may be on the horizon when body temperatures rise from inadequate heat management.

Humidity

The months with the lowest humidity are January and February, with an average relative humidity of 80%.

Rainfall

The month with the least rainfall is January, when the rain falls for 18.9 days and typically collects 85mm (3.35") of precipitation.

Daylight

In Pelawatta, Sri Lanka, the average length of the day in January is 11h and 48min.
On the first day of January, sunrise is at 06:19 and sunset at 18:05. On the last day of the month, sunrise is at 06:26 and sunset at 18:17 +0530.

Sunshine

In January, the average sunshine is 8.3h.

UV index

The months with the highest UV index are January through August, November and December, with an average maximum UV index of 6. A UV Index value of 6 to 7 symbolizes a high health risk from exposure to the Sun's UV rays for average individuals.
Note: The maximum UV index of 6 during January translates into these guidelines:
Stand by precautions and apply sun safety measures. Evading sunburn is of great importance. Remember that the sun's UV radiation is strongest between 10 a.m. and 4 p.m. Make an effort to avoid direct sun exposure during these hours. Wearing a wide-brim hat can block approximately 50% of UV radiation, protecting the eyes.
